OUrs is another good one- We've had it for a good 7-8 years now for sure and it's still a strong runner. Does need a new gas line once in a while but that's expected with pretty much anything... It replaced an older 5 HP walk-behind that was a peice of crap. Works faster and gives better results. We will rent a monster rear tine tiller once in a great while though if we need to do a really large area and a tractor can't get to it... Donovan from Wisconsin
